Did a scorpion or snake sting Abu Bakr Al-Siddiq (may Allah be pleased with him) in the cave while the Prophet (peace be upon him) was sleeping on his lap?

Al-Munawi, Ala' al-Din, Al-Suyuti, and Ibn Kathir mentioned the story of the snakebite inflicted upon Abu Bakr in the cave. Ibn Kathir stated that Al-Bayhaqi narrated it in "Al-Dala'il" on the authority of Umar, and that it contains strangeness and denunciation. This story has not been established with an authentic or acceptable chain of transmission, and what has been authentically proven regarding the virtues of Abu Bakr, may Allah be pleased with him, suffices without it.
